Software quality measurement and modeling, maturity, control and improvement
The goal of the paper is to provide a measurement structure needed for the improvement of software quality by uniting the Rome Laboratory Software Quality Framework, a reconstructed concept of measurement based maturity, statistical analysis, data quality and requisite information structures. The structure involves both standards of practice and standards of performance relating to product and process, and the need for extended forms of analysis for them to be developed. Such a structure is essential if software quality is to be assessed and improved in a timely manner.
